Grasping Registered Agents

A official agent is a necessary part of business establishment, acting as an middleman between the business and the state. Their main role is to get legal paperwork, such as service of process notifications and government communications, ensuring that the company remains in compliance with statutory requirements. Registered agents are usually required for LLCs and incorporated entities to maintain favorable standing and fulfill legal obligations.

When choosing a registered agent, entities can choose between in-state or national providers, depending on their unique needs. A reliable registered agent ensures that essential documents are handled securely and delivered promptly to the business. They provide additional services like yearly compliance reminders, management of legal paperwork, and entity management, which can be extremely useful for ensuring systematic records and staying compliant with laws.

In many situations, businesses opt for professional registered agent services to take advantage from the expertise offered by dedicated professionals. These services often include maintaining a registered office, coordinating service of process deliveries, and supplying business mail handling solutions. Fees and Expenses of Registered Agent Services

When thinking about the use of registered agent services, comprehending the associated expenses and pricing is important for efficient budgeting. The price of hiring a registered agent can vary widely based on considerations such as the provider's credibility, location, and the range of services included. Typically, annual fees for a registered agent fall between $50 to three hundred dollars, with many companies offering packages that offer additional features such as compliance monitoring and annual report filing.

Approved Agent Criteria by Region

Every region within the United States has its specific distinct registered agent requirements that companies are required to comply with when establishing an organization. Generally, a registered agent is required to be a local of the state where the business is registered or a company permitted to conduct business in that region. This provides that there is a reliable individual or entity to accept important law-related and tax documents on behalf of the company. The registered agent must have a tangible location in the state, which is frequently referred to as the registered address.

Some states permit entities to act as their individual registered agent, but this might not be advisable for every entities. For instance, having a professional registered agent can provide extra privacy and guarantees that company founders do not overlook critical legal notices. Specific professions or entities, like nonprofits or foreign corporations, might have additional requirements to fulfill regarding their registered agent selection. It's crucial for companies to verify the specific regulations in their state to confirm adherence.

Advantages of Hiring a Designated Agent

One of the primary benefits of hiring a designated agent is the assurance of legal compliance. A designated agent helps businesses meet their legal obligations by receiving important legal documents, such as service of process, tax notifications, and annual report reminders. This ensures that essential correspondence is handled swiftly, reducing the risk of missed deadlines that could lead to penalties or even the closure of the company.

Additionally, having a registered agent offers a layer of privacy for business owners. By using a registered agent service, your personal address is kept off public records, which can protect your privacy and reduce unwanted solicitation. This is particularly beneficial for home-based companies or new ventures that prefer a discreet approach to their corporate affairs.
